Tool Description This guide is a set of resources that captures the state of the art in psychological services to older adults and especially to those in long term care. These materials cover individual, family and organizational interventions as well as psychological and neuropsychological assessment of older adults in long term care. The problems encountered reflect the full range of symptomatic (DSM Axis I) and personality (DSM Axis II) areas including dementia diagnosis and management. This resource guide offers a series of books, book chapters and journal articles which collectively address this range of issues.
